A'ja Wilson holds the top spot in the WNBA points per game race at 25.9, driving the strong trader consensus around her as the season leader. The Las Vegas forward has maintained elite scoring efficiency while adding defensive production and team success that bolsters her position over the first month of play. Kelsey Plum sits close behind at 25.5, keeping her relevant in the market, while Caitlin Clark's 18.7 scoring average reflects her heavier emphasis on playmaking and assists. Other contenders like Breanna Stewart and Kelsey Mitchell trail further back, with no major injuries or lineup shifts reported that would immediately alter the current hierarchy.

In the event of a tie for the highest points per game average, this market will resolve in favor of the player who appeared in the greater number of games. If the tied players also played the same number of games, the market will resolve in favor of the player whose listed last name comes first alphabetically.
Qualification for inclusion in official WNBA leaderboards (such as minimum games or statistical thresholds) will be determined according to WNBA rules and applied exactly as reflected in the official leaderboard.
If the 2026 WNBA regular season is cancelled, postponed after October 8, 2026, 11:59 PM ET, or if an official leader has not been declared within that timeframe, this market will resolve to "Other".
The resolution source will be the WNBA (https://stats.wnba.com/players/traditional/).
